About Handbook of Layered Materials

Focusing on layered compounds at the core of materials intercalation chemistry, the Handbook of Layered Materials explores clays and other classes of materials exhibiting the ability to pillar, or establish permanent intracrystalline porosity within layers. Explaining basic concepts first before delving into more scientifically complex topics, the book presents fundamental properties as well as summaries of cutting-edge research results. It outlines modern usages of clays and other layered materials, including catalytic and photocatalytic applications and examines the chemistry of clays, pillared clays, and pillared heterostructures.
